Indian Railways revenue up 10%

Indian Railways has registered a growth of 10.22% in earnings for the period of April-November 2011.

The rail operator reported an income of Rs. 66126.39 crore compared to Rs. 59994.24 crore during the same period last year.

From goods, Indian Railways earned Rs 43888.10 crore in April-November 2011 as against Rs. 39855.04 crore earned during the same period last year, registering an increase of 10.12%.

The total passenger revenue earnings during first eight months of the financial year increased by 9.67%.

The revenue earnings from other coaching amounted to Rs. 1860.46 crore during April- November 2011 compared to Rs. 1668.15 crore during the same period last year, an increase of 11.53%.

The total approximate numbers of passengers booked during April- November 2011 has increased by 5.24%.

In the suburban and non-suburban sectors, the numbers of passengers booked during April-November 2011 was 2777.81 million and 2740.87 million showing an increase of 3.84% and 6.70% respectively when compared to last year.

Railways carried 618 million tonnes of revenue earning freight traffic during April-November 2011, registering an increase of 4.14% increase, against freight traffic of 593.44 million tonnes actually carried during the corresponding period last year.
